Studi Kasus Latihan 8.1 (Struktur Data - Modul 8)
Konsep stack di logikakan seperti sebuah tumpukan barang yang tersusun
ke atas dengan ketinggian tumpukan yang telah ditentukan. Untuk
mengilustrasikannya program dibawah ini.
Source Code:
Hasil Running:
Apabila lebih dari 20:
Penjelasan:
Program ini digunakan untuk menumpukan sebuah nilai yang diinputkan jumlah nilai yang diinput disesuaikan dengan nilai awal yang diberikan. Akan tetapi hanya sampai 20 angka karena telah disesuaikan dengan define.
Program ini menggunakan struct untuk menyimpan data. Didalamnya terdapat 2 elemen / field int atas digunakan untuk menyimpan data paling atas atau baru masuk, dan nilai[N] akan menyimpan tumpukan nilai.
Di
dalam program ini menggunakan variabel nilai, i, dan jumlah. Variabel
nilai diluar struk ini bertujuan memasukan nilai kembali ke dalam
struktur, variabel i digunakan untuk perulangan for, dan variabel jml
digunakan untuk menentukan jumlah nilai yang akan dimasukan.
0 komentar:
Posting Komentar